Crown Holdings, Inc. (CCK) Insider Sales and Financial Overview

Crown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:CCK) is a leading global supplier of packaging products for consumer goods. The company specializes in the production of metal packaging for food, beverage, household, and personal care products. Crown Holdings competes with other packaging giants like Ball Corporation and Ardagh Group. The company is known for its innovative packaging solutions and strong market presence.

On February 20, 2026, Gifford Gerard H, the Executive Vice President and Chief Accounting Officer of Crown Holdings, sold 13,373 shares of the company's common stock at approximately $113.98 each. This transaction is significant as it reflects insider activity within the company. After the sale, Gifford Gerard H retains 106,310 shares, indicating continued confidence in the company's prospects.

In a similar move, CEO Timothy Donahue sold 7,500 shares at an average price of $110.67, totaling around $830,000. This sale reduced his ownership by 1.56%, leaving him with 474,736 shares valued at approximately $52.5 million. Such insider sales are often scrutinized by investors as they can provide insights into the executives' perspectives on the company's future.

Crown Holdings' stock opened at $114.80 in the latest trading session, with a current price of $114.80, reflecting a 0.97% increase. The stock has traded between $113.10 and $114.96 today. Over the past year, it has seen a low of $75.90 and a high of $115.85, indicating significant volatility. The company's market capitalization is approximately $13.24 billion.

Financially, Crown Holdings maintains a current ratio of 1.03 and a quick ratio of 0.66, suggesting moderate liquidity. The debt-to-equity ratio of 1.55 indicates a higher reliance on debt financing. The price-to-earnings ratio of 18.02 and PEG ratio of 1.34 suggest that the stock is reasonably valued. The beta of 0.73 indicates lower volatility compared to the market.
